Hi,

I have one company and 2 financial dimensions- Area and Worker in my accounting structure.

I am trying to create a link between both my financial dimensions in such a way that whenever user selects Area dimensions only the specific worker dimensions appear to him or allow him to select relevant workers only. 

Both these dimensions are custom dimension.

The financial dimension values for worker and area keep on changing during a year.

If I try to fix this setup on account structure then I will have to keep on changing accounting structure every time a new worker is added. Additionally, account structure will also become too big. 

We have around 41 areas and 500 worker financial dimension values.

I want to know whether there is any setup in AX 2012 R3 which I can use ? or did I need to go for customization only ?

    Hi ankag,

    If you continue using the worker findim then you will always run into the issue that you have to update your account structure once new workers arrive.

    Can't you realize the setup by moving one level up?

    That is by grouping your employees and rather use a custom 'worker group' findim?

    Once a new employee arrives, you assign him this worker group fin dim and things should be fine.

    What do you think about this approach?

    Hello ankag,

    In D365FO we got a new functionality that allows linking findims.

    This feature is, however, not available in AX2012 and if your management insists on that you will end up with a customization.
